Material selection directly impacts ease of installation, length flexibility, and long‑term system reliability. Polycarbonate FAST sampling tubes are engineered to support demanding industrial and commercial environments while offering advantages that traditional metal tubing does not always provide.
One of the most immediate benefits is reduced weight. Polycarbonate tubes are significantly lighter than metal, making handling and placement easier—especially in overhead ductwork or large installations. This not only improves installation efficiency but can also reduce installer fatigue and handling challenges in confined mechanical spaces.
Flexibility in assembly is another key advantage. In systems where duct configurations are complex or space is limited, the ability to assemble and adapt the length of sampling tubes can simplify installation. Polycarbonate’s inherent ease of use supports tighter space and duct dimensions while maintaining structural integrity.
Durability remains a core consideration in life‑safety applications. FAST sampling tubes are designed with strong, impact and heat resistant material performance, helping them withstand jobsite conditions and long‑term operational use. This balance of strength and flexibility allows designers and installers to adopt a more adaptable approach without compromising system performance.
In real‑world projects, specifications are not always fully defined at the time of ordering. Renovations, retrofits, phased construction, and last‑minute design changes can all affect required sampling tube lengths.
APC’s FAST tubes are designed to be easily cut to length in the field, making them especially valuable when multiple sizes may be required or when final measurements are not confirmed until installation. For specifying engineers, this adaptability supports more resilient designs. For installers, it reduces the risk of delays caused by incorrect tube lengths or missing components.
